Legal Challenges Facing LGBTQ+ Victims in Elder Cases
Many LGBTQ+ victims of elder sexual abuse face unique challenges when coming forward and seeking justice, often due to systemic discrimination and a lack of awareness among legal professionals and law enforcement in San Diego. These cases are complex, requiring specialized knowledge to navigate the legal system effectively. Elderly sexual assault law firms in San Diego that have experience handling these sensitive matters can provide much-needed support.
One significant barrier is the historical marginalization and underrepresentation of LGBTQ+ individuals within the legal framework, leading to potential bias and misunderstandings during investigations and trials. Victims may also struggle with disclosure, fear stigma, and lack of social support, making it crucial for lawyers to offer a safe and inclusive environment. Additionally, proving consent or lack thereof in cases involving elderly individuals can be intricate, as cognitive impairment or dementia might impact an individual’s capacity to give informed consent. LGBTQ+ victims require legal representation that understands these nuances and advocates tirelessly for their rights.
